the sum of the interior angles of a polygon is
sum = 180° (n - 2) ← n is the number of sides
given the sum of the interior angles is 3240° , then
180° (n - 2) = 3240 ( divide both sides by 180° )
n - 2 = 18 ( add 2 to both sides )
n = 20
then the polygon is a 20- gon

HELP PLS! A boat is heading towards a lighthouse, whose beacon-light is 102 feet above the water. From point AA, the boat’s crew measures the angle of elevation to the beacon, 13^{\circ}
, before they draw closer. They measure the angle of elevation a second time from point BB at some later time to be 22^{\circ}
. Find the distance from point AA to point BB. Round your answer to the nearest tenth of a foot if necessary.
Answer:
Distance from point AA to point BB = 189.3 feet
Step-by-step explanation:
Let the distance from point AA to the base of the lighthouse be represented by x, and the distance from point BB to the base of the lighthouse be represented by y. So that;
distance from point AA to point BB = x - y
To determine the value of x, applying the required trigonometric function;
Tan θ = \(\frac{opposite}{sdjacent}\)
Tan 13 = \(\frac{102}{x}\)
x = \(\frac{102}{Tan 13}\)
= 441.81 feet
x = 441.8 feet
To determine the value of y;
Tan 22 = \(\frac{102}{y}\)
y = \(\frac{102}{Tan 22}\)
= 252.46
y = 252.5 feet
Thus,
distance from point AA to point BB = 441.8 - 252.5
= 189.3 feet

Given y varies directly as x, then the equation relating them is
y = kx ← k is the constant of variation
To find k use the condition when x = 20, y = 12, then
12 = 20k ( divide both sides by 20 )
k = \(\frac{12}{20}\) = \(\frac{3}{5}\)
y = \(\frac{3}{5}\) x ← equation of variation
When x = 15, then
y = \(\frac{3}{5}\) × 15 = 9
